Travel+Leisure (NYSE:TNL) reported quarterly earnings of $1.83 per share which beat the analyst consensus estimate of $1.80 by 1.44 percent. This is a 6.4 percent increase over earnings of $1.72 per share from the same period last year. The company reported quarterly sales of $1.026 billion which beat the analyst consensus estimate of $1.001 billion by 2.51 percent. This is a 5.66 percent increase over sales of $971.000 million the same period last year.
